Sicilian

edit

Etymology

edit

Possibly - because of the feminine gender and the palatalization on the last syllable - from (or influenced by) Old French espinoche, from Old Occitan espinarc, ultimately from Arabic إِسْفَانَاخ (ʔisfānāḵ), from Classical Persian اسپناخ (ispanāx, ispināx).

Pronunciation

edit
  • IPA(key): /spiˈna.ʃa/, [spɪˈna.ʃa], [ʃpɪ-]
  • Hyphenation: spi‧nà‧cia

Noun

edit

spinacia f (invariable)

  1. spinach
